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Target New Britain Ct Hours
Results for
Target New Britain Ct Hours
Related Searches
target new britain ct hours
target new britain hours
target store new britain ct
target in new britain ct
target store new britian ct
target optical in new britain ct
target eye center new britain ct
target new britain ave
target in new britain
target optical new britain